Every Bugatti leaving Molsheim undergoes a strict quality control process, and the track-only Bolide is no exception. Before reaching its owner, each Bolide faces an intensive final inspection and circuit testing to ensure absolute perfection.
With 1,600 horsepower and a lightweight carbon fiber chassis, the Bolide is the most extreme expression of Bugatti’s DNA.

Its final validation takes place at Circuit de Mirecourt, where Bugatti’s expert team rigorously tests its performance under controlled conditions.

The shakedown process involves a dedicated team of specialists and is divided into two phases. The first focuses on precision, with gradual braking tests, steering validation, and system checks at increasing speeds.

The second phase pushes the car to its limits, including high-speed laps up to 300 km/h, launch control activations, and extreme braking forces of -2.5G with temperatures reaching 1,000°C.

Using advanced telemetry and expert human assessment, Bugatti ensures every Bolide meets its exacting standards.
